I’m excited for Shaun T’s next program coming out in December called INSANITY MAX:30. This one looks intense! I did Insanity a while ago and loved it! It was a great way to get back in shape after my first kiddo. One of the reason’s I haven’t got back to Insanity was because of how much longer the workouts are compared to like Focus T25 or P90X3. Many of the workouts were close to an hour long. Now Insanity is back and workouts in Max:30 are only 30 mins. I love that!

Shaun T has developed 150 new cardio and strength moves that will make you push harder and dig deeper than ever before to get the best body of your life in just 60 days. You’ll get killer cardio and tabata strength workouts. There’s no equipment needed and a modifier in every workout so anyone can push to their MAX. It’s not about “getting through” all 30 minutes, it’s about going as hard as possible, for as long as possible, until becoming “MAXED OUT” (i.e. until taking the first rest and/or breaking proper form).
